About Andromeda

Andromeda Cluster was founded by Nat Friedman and Daniel Gross to give early-stage startups access to the kind of scaled AI infrastructure once reserved only for hyperscalers.

We began with a single managed cluster — but it filled almost instantly. Since then, we’ve been quietly building the systems, network, and orchestration layer that makes the world’s AI infrastructure more accessible.

Today, Andromeda works with leading AI labs, data centers, and cloud providers to deliver compute when and where it’s needed most. Our platform routes training and inference jobs across global supply, unlocking flexibility and efficiency in one of the fastest-growing markets on earth.

Our long-term vision is to build the liquidity layer for global AI compute. We are expanding to new frontiers to find the brightest that work in AI infrastructure, research and engineering.

The Role

This role owns our provider relationships on the technical side. You're the person who decides whether a provider's cluster is good enough to join the Andromeda network, and the person who helps them get there when it isn't. That means vetting prospective providers against our quality bar and then working alongside their engineers to bring their clusters onto the network cleanly.

You'll work closely with our compute procurement team to identify and qualify new providers, and you'll be the standing technical relationship with the providers we already have. When procurement finds a promising provider, you're the one who validates the claims. When a provider says their fabric is non-blocking and their nodes are burn-in tested, you're the one who verifies it by reviewing their evidence, and sometimes by running the tests yourself on their hardware.

The qualification bar you'll hold providers to mostly doesn't exist yet in written form. Some of it lives informally in how our SREs evaluate clusters today; much of it hasn't been defined at all. You'd be the first person in this role, so a large part of the job is building that bar: the acceptance test suite, the quality thresholds, and the technical standards a provider must meet. Then making them rigorous enough that we can trust them and clear enough that providers can build to them.

This role is the technical counterpart to our Provider Technical Program Manager, who owns delivery timelines, escalations, and incident command. You own the technical judgment: is this cluster ready, what's wrong with it, and what will it take to fix. During provider incidents, command and coordination sit with the program manager and technical response sits with our SREs. Your involvement is upstream, making sure clusters that would have caused those incidents never make it onto the network.

What You’ll Do

  • Vet prospective compute providers: assess cluster architecture, GPU hardware, network fabric, storage, and orchestration against Andromeda's quality metrics, and make the call on whether a cluster qualifies.

  • Define the qualification bar itself. Build the acceptance test suite, benchmark methodology, and quality thresholds from scratch, formalizing what currently exists only as SRE tribal knowledge. Own and evolve these standards as the fleet and the market change.

  • Run validation hands-on where it matters: burn-in testing, fabric validation (InfiniBand/RoCE), NCCL and application-level benchmarks, storage performance testing. For routine or repeat validation, define the methodology and review results rather than executing everything yourself.

  • Guide providers through technical onboarding: work directly with their data-center and platform engineers to remediate gaps, tune configurations, and bring clusters up to the bar on a predictable path.

  • Partner with compute procurement to identify and qualify new providers. Perform technical due diligence during sourcing, and a clear read on how much remediation a candidate cluster needs before procurement commits.

  • Build and maintain technical relationships with existing providers: you're the engineer their engineers call, and the one who spots architectural or quality drift before it becomes a customer problem.

  • Feed what you learn back into provider-facing standards and internal documentation, so each qualification is faster and more consistent than the last.

What We’re Looking For

  • Deep HPC experience: you've designed, built, or operated GPU clusters at meaningful scale and understand what makes them fast, stable, and debuggable.

  • Strong fabric knowledge, ideally both InfiniBand and RoCE. You can evaluate a topology, interpret fabric diagnostics, and identify why a fabric underperforms, not just that it does.

  • Experience with distributed orchestration and the HPC software stack: Slurm, Kubernetes, OpenMPI or equivalent, and the Linux systems engineering underneath all of it.

  • Data-center literacy: power, cooling, cabling, and physical-layer realities. You can walk a provider's facility and know what questions to ask.

  • Benchmarking judgment. You know which numbers matter for large-scale training workloads, how providers game them, and how to design tests that can't be gamed.

  • The ability to write standards others can build against: precise, testable, and usable by a provider's engineering team without you in the room.

  • Credibility in the room with external engineering teams, including the ability to deliver a failing grade to a provider who wants your business, and keep the relationship intact.

  • Comfort with ambiguity. The qualification framework you'll apply mostly doesn't exist yet; you'll write it.

Strong Candidates May Have

  • Experience inside a neocloud, hyperscaler, colocation, or data-center provider.

  • NVIDIA data-center GPU depth: DGX/HGX platforms, NVLink/NVSwitch, GPU health and RAS behavior at fleet scale.

  • Experience supporting AI research labs or other large-scale training customers, and familiarity with what their workloads punish: stragglers, fabric jitter, storage stalls.

  • Background in cluster acceptance testing or site bring-up. Ideally you've taken a cluster from delivery to production before.

What you need to know about the NYC Tech Scene

As the undisputed financial capital of the world, New York City is an epicenter of startup funding activity. The city has a thriving fintech scene and is a major player in verticals ranging from AI to biotech, cybersecurity and digital media. It also has universities like NYU, Columbia and Cornell Tech attracting students and researchers from across the globe, providing the ecosystem with a constant influx of world-class talent. And its East Coast location and three international airports make it a perfect spot for European companies establishing a foothold in the United States.

Key Facts About NYC Tech

  • Number of Tech Workers: 549,200; 6% of overall workforce (2024 CompTIA survey)
  • Major Tech Employers: Capgemini, Bloomberg, IBM, Spotify
  • Key Industries: Artificial intelligence, Fintech
  • Funding Landscape: $25.5 billion in venture capital funding in 2024 (Pitchbook)
  • Notable Investors: Greycroft, Thrive Capital, Union Square Ventures, FirstMark Capital, Tiger Global Management, Tribeca Venture Partners, Insight Partners, Two Sigma Ventures
  • Research Centers and Universities: Columbia University, New York University, Fordham University, CUNY, AI Now Institute, Flatiron Institute, C.N. Yang Institute for Theoretical Physics, NASA Space Radiation Laboratory
